Factors driving a productivity explosion
A recent uptick in measured U.S. productivity is prompting debate over what’s actually driving it, with many pointing to widespread remote work, better job–worker matching across geographies, and early use of AI coding tools as key factors. Others argue that macro productivity stats mostly reflect GDP growth and labor-force dynamics rather than individuals working “harder,” and note that threats of layoffs, underreported inflation, or unfilled low-value jobs could be distorting the picture. The conversation also surfaces tensions around return‑to‑office mandates, offshoring of remote‑capable roles, and whether gains from higher productivity are being shared with workers through wages or better working conditions.
Remote work, RTO, and productivity
- Many report being at least as productive, often more, when working from home due to fewer distractions, no commute, and better personal scheduling.
- Several say companies openly admit remote productivity and profitability, yet still push RTO for vague reasons like “giving it our best,” which is seen as contradictory.
- Some argue WFH is especially beneficial for parents and for quality of life outside work.
- Others stress that the key is communication quality; dense, text-heavy work fits WFH well, but “most office workers” are not programmers.
Offshoring, labor pools, and job security
- A strong theme: if work can be done from home, it can be offshored to cheaper countries. Some report their roles already moved to India.
- Counterpoint: truly top developers abroad are not dramatically cheaper, especially after management and coordination costs; timezone and culture also matter.
- WFH is seen as expanding the talent pool beyond 1-hour commute radii, producing better employer–employee matches and potentially higher aggregate productivity.
- Others worry expanded supply of workers could push wages down, though there is disagreement on net effect.
AI tools and developer productivity
- Several developers say generative AI makes them somewhat to significantly more productive, especially for boilerplate code and “playing around” with ideas.
- They note AI does not solve the hardest parts of the job but reduces time spent on routine work. Some admit accepting lower-quality code because it’s faster.
Commuting, fairness, and compensation
- Many argue in-office workers effectively work more due to commute and prep time and should be compensated, either in pay, hours, or expenses.
- Others respond that people choose where they live, so commute costs are their responsibility; compensating commute time could incentivize excessively long commutes.
- Some point out WFH workers now shoulder costs of home office space and infrastructure, which previously fell on employers.
Interpreting “productivity boom”
- Several commenters emphasize the difference between economic productivity (GDP per hour worked) and individual effort.
- Explanations offered include strong GDP growth with modest employment growth, underreported inflation, and sectoral shifts, not just WFH or AI.
- Some see fear of layoffs as a driver; others find that inconsistent with low headline unemployment and say evidence is anecdotal and unclear.
